Emergency Water Removal in Phoenix, AZ
Emergency water removal services provide immediate assistance for homeowners facing unexpected water intrusions, such as burst pipes, appliance failures, or flooding caused by storms. These services involve rapid extraction of standing water from affected areas, including basements, garages, and living spaces, to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th. Property owners typically seek this service when water levels threaten to compromise structural integrity or cause extensive damage, and they want to understand the scope of water removal needed, the affected areas, and the steps involved in drying and restoring the property.
Before requesting emergency water removal, property owners should assess the extent of water intrusion and identify sources of the flooding. It’s important to determine whether electrical systems are affected and if there are potential hazards present. Clear communication about the size of the affected area, the type of water involved (clean, gray, or black water), and any immediate safety concerns can help ensure an effective response. Proper assessment and prompt action are essential to minimizing damage and supporting the restoration process.

Emergency Water Removal Questions
What types of water removal services are available? Services include extraction of water from carpets, flooring, and structural elements after flooding or leaks.
How can water damage affect a property? Water damage can lead to mold growth, structural issues, and damage to personal belongings if not addressed promptly.
What situations typically require emergency water removal? Emergency removal is needed after plumbing failures, storm flooding, or appliance leaks that cause significant water intrusion.
What should property owners do before professionals arrive? Remove excess water if possible and clear the area to allow access for cleanup and drying efforts.
